In this work, a radiometric method is used for the determination of the oil drop size distribution in agitated hydrocarbon–water systems. The influence of the counter position, the oil concentration, and the rotation speed of impeller were studied. An experimental parameter is proposed for the definition of the drop size distribution. It was observed that an unsymmetrical distribution represents the drop size distribution better than the normal distribution law.
